How do you waterproof a basement?

Usually waterproofing of basement means repairing of cracks in foundation walls with injection of epoxy or polyurethane into the cracks. When water comes from the floor, it means your drainage system does not work, this could be fixed by cleaning/repairing existing system or installing new system inside the basement.


What is basement waterproofing?

Basement waterproofing refers to the process of making a basement or cellar water-resistant. It involves various techniques and methods that are used to prevent water from penetrating into the basement and causing damage to the foundation and walls of the building. Some of the common methods of basement waterproofing include installing a sump pump, sealing cracks and gaps in the walls and floor, installing drainage systems, and applying waterproof coatings or membranes. These methods are designed to redirect or prevent the entry of water into the basement and protect the structure from water damage. Basement waterproofing is important because water damage can lead to structural problems, mold growth, and other health hazards. By preventing water from entering the basement, homeowners can ensure that their property remains safe and secure.


How do you stop a leak in a basement at one specific spot?

To stop a leak in a basement at a specific spot, first identify the source of the water intrusion, such as cracks in the foundation or gaps around pipes. Clean the area thoroughly and use hydraulic cement or a waterproof sealant to fill in any cracks or holes. Additionally, consider applying a waterproof membrane or coating to the walls and floor around the spot for added protection. Finally, ensure proper drainage outside the home to prevent future leaks.

How can I effectively waterproof my basement floor?

To effectively waterproof your basement floor, you can use a combination of sealants, waterproofing paints, and epoxy coatings. Start by cleaning the floor thoroughly and repairing any cracks or damage. Then, apply a waterproof sealant or paint specifically designed for concrete surfaces. For added protection, consider applying an epoxy coating on top of the sealant. This will create a durable and waterproof barrier that helps prevent water damage in your basement.
